Output 905304ec5f6f995033d557a1430ad1f0b7aaabbca12c75189b0f8e4725d4d756:1

value
38156050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f95b5ab9af3306d3a8d4677e4143df680f97057 OP_EQUAL
address
MGcZmfQFdhtsBMrC3Qsfbixps4Uzx4zViP
transaction
905304ec5f6f995033d557a1430ad1f0b7aaabbca12c75189b0f8e4725d4d756
spent
true